Impact of Microbes on Product Durability

Microorganisms such as bacteria and mold can significantly affect the longevity and appearance of products. They can cause material breakdown, leading to structural weaknesses, unpleasant odors, discoloration, and accelerated wear, especially in frequently used or challenging environments.

AntiBactabs technology is integrated into products during the manufacturing process, providing continuous antimicrobial protection. This built-in defense mechanism inhibits the growth of microbes on treated surfaces, ensuring products remain cleaner and more durable over time.
